Konular
WordPress 503 Service Unavailable hatası, bir web sunucusunun gelen isteği işlemek için yeterli kapasiteye sahip olmadığını belirtir. 503 Hatasının deneleri genel olarak birden fazla sebepten oluşabilmektedir.
Sunucu Aşırı Yükü
WordPress siteniz yüksek trafikli ise, sunucunuzun kaynakları bu yoğunluğu karşılayamayabilir.
Bakım Modu
WordPress, bazı eklentiler veya manuel olarak yapılan bakımlar sırasında geçici bir bakım moduna geçebilir. Bu durumda, siteye erişim sağlanamaz ve 503 hatası meydana gelir.
Eklenti veya Tema Çakışmaları
Eklentiler veya temalar, güncellemeler veya hatalı kodlar nedeniyle uyumsuz hale gelebilir. Bu çakışmalar sunucu kaynaklarını aşırı derecede zorlayabilir ve hata verebilir.
PHP Limitleri
WordPress, PHP ile çalışır ve bazı sunucularda PHP limitleri düşük olabilir. Bu durumda PHP işlemleri tamamlanamayabilir ve 503 hatası oluşabilir.
DDoS Saldırıları
Eğer sitenize yönelik bir DDoS saldırısı varsa, aşırı trafik sunucuyu etkileyebilir ve 503 hatası alabilirsiniz.
503 Hatası İçin Çözüm Yöntemleri
Bakım Modunu Kapatmak
Eğer siteyi bir bakım modunda çalıştırdıysanız, .maintenance dosyasını silmek sorunu çözebilir. Bu dosya WordPress güncelleme işlemleri sırasında otomatik olarak oluşturulur. Bakım Modu pasif etme makalemizi inceleyerek ve ilgili ve işlemi sağlayarak ilgili durumu çözebilirsiniz.
Eklenti ve Tema Çakışmalarını Kontrol Etmek
Eklentilerden birinin hatalı çalışması durumunda, FTP veya dosya yöneticisini kullanarak eklentileri devre dışı bırakmak gerekebilir. Ardından, her bir eklentiyi tek tek kontrol ederek hatalı olanı bulabilirsiniz. cPanel / WordPress Tema veya Eklenti Deaktif Etme makalemizi inceleyerek ve işlem sağlayarak ilgili durumu tespit edebilirsiniz.
PHP Limitsini Artırmak
Sunucu kaynaklarınızı yükseltmek için PHP limitlerini artırmayı deneyebilirsiniz. Bunun için .htaccess dosyanızda max_execution_time, memory_limit ve upload_max_filesize gibi vb. değerlerini artırabilirsiniz. WordPress Memory Limitini Arttırmak adlı makalemizi inceleyebilirsiniz.
Sunucu Kaynaklarını Kontrol Etmek
Sunucu kaynaklarınızın cPanel üzerinde yer alan Resource usage üzerinden yeterli olup olmadığını kontrol etmeniz ve kaynaklarınız yüksek ise genel inceleme sağlanması için tarafımıza destek talebinde bulunabilirsiniz.
Cache Temizliği ve Optimizasyon
Önbellek eklentileri (örneğin Litespeed Cache ) kullanıyorsanız, önbelleği temizleyerek hatayı giderebilirsiniz. Temanız bu cache eklentisini destekliyor ise LiteSpeed Cache kurulumu ve WordPress LiteSpeed Cache Önerilen Ayarları makalelerimizi inceleyebilir ve işlem sağlayabilirsiniz.
Ayrıca veritabanı optimizasyonu yapmak da faydalı olabilir. Bu konuda aşağıdaki görselimizi inceleyebilirsiniz. İşlem öncesinde veri tabanı yedeğinizi almanızı ayrıca öneririz.
DDoS Saldırısı Durumunda
Bir DDoS saldırısı altında olduğunuzdan şüpheleniyorsanız, tarafımız ile iletişime geçerek bilgi edinebilirsiniz.
Sonuç
WordPress’teki 503 Service Unavailable hatası genellikle geçici bir sorun olup, doğru önlemler alındığında çözülebilir. Sunucu kaynakları, eklenti uyumsuzlukları, bakım modu ve PHP limitleri en yaygın nedenlerdir. Bu hatayı çözmek için düzenli bakım yapmanız, eklenti ve tema güncellemelerini takip etmeniz ve sunucu kaynaklarınızı gözden geçirmeniz önemlidir.